    This only works on the Gigabyte SLi mobo at present (according to the Firingsquad review). Their reviews clocked it at below a single 6800GT. Not sure how much it costs but if it's *much* cheaper than a 6800GT then it's a good deal but otherwise it would be better to get a 6800GT. In addition, the 3D1 needs SLi enabled so you're already wasting the second slot. With a single 6800GT you've still got the option to stick another identical one in and enable SLi.
